Rep. Maxine Waters At War Against The Tea Party Movement
http://annem040359.wordpress.com/ ^ | August 22, 2011 | annem040359

Posted on 08/22/2011 5:13:32 PM PDT by Biggirl

When it comes to acting “civil” it is in regards to this USA House of Representatives, Rep. Maxine Waters, (D/CA), the call to act “civil” has fallen on her deaf ears.

This past Saturday, back home, Rep. Waters had nothing but harsh words to say about the tea party movement, from “The Daily Caller” :

“This is a tough game. You can’t be intimidated. You can’t be frightened. And as far as I’m concerned — the tea party can go straight to hell.”
